** Senior Administrative Partner**! This position is located at the company’s World Headquarters in
** Midland, Michigan**.You will facilitate and coordinate the activities of the Chief Investment Officer, President of Insurance and Global Director of Corporate Venture Capital, provide support for the associated teams and manage the office.  These teams oversee the investment of $33+ Billion of retirement and insurance company assets, operate the reinsurance business, implement the company corporate risk management programs and make strategic direct corporate venture capital investments.

You will need to exercise considerable discretion and independent judgement in managing the coordination and flow of activities and deliverables among the teams and with internal / external parties.  You will work with a limited degree of supervision and act on behalf of the supported leader.
** Responsibilities
* * You will need to maintain an in-depth understanding of the role, team objectives, the work environment and their interaction.  You will work independently and appropriately prioritize work to provide professional support, as well as identify, anticipate and address needs of leadership.

You will serve as a communication focal point with the ability to rapidly establish rapport between senior leadership and internal / external parties. High-level organization and prioritization skills are needed to meet tight deadlines in a fast-paced and quickly changing environment. We are looking for someone who is proactive, resourceful and self-motivated, with the ability to exercise appropriate judgement to take action.  

You will also supervise other administrative & temporary employees.
* Gain and maintain a strong understanding of the leader and the business/function to screen and prioritize written / verbal communications and meeting requests.  Discern which requests require the leader’s attention and resolve those that shouldn’t.  Have the ability and knowledge to answer business/function questions and take appropriate actions in the absence of the leader.
* Organize complex calendar and time management needs to support the leader’s interaction with the team and internal / external parties, ensuring business objectives are met. Independently work to manage changing priorities and circumstances.
* Independently coordinate the end-to-end delivery of business / group meetings and events, board / committee meetings, and special projects (Plan, schedule, coordinate and implement).  Act as the focal point for agendas, logistics, conferencing and guest arrangements. Anticipate meeting needs and technology requirements and ensure seamless meetings and events by testing their efficacy and making contingency plans prior to the event.  

Provide support to visitors.
* Arrange complex domestic and international travel and itinerary preparation that often includes coordination across multiple modes of transportation and interactions with numerous external parties at varying venues.  Foresee all facets of travel needs, completing where appropriate, required paperwork for passports and visas and their details, such as photos etc. Guide personnel on vaccination requirements/Dow medical needs before traveling. Understand time zones, realities of various transportation methods, cultural differences and anticipate their impact on the planning of agendas.
